概括
一个新的深度学习模型,PDRF-Net,在CT扫描中准确地细分COVID-19肺部病变. 这种先进的细分有助于更快地诊断和监测COVID-19患者.
科学领域:
- 医疗成像医学成像
- 人工智能的人工智能
- 计算机视觉 计算机视觉
背景情况:
- COVID-19的诊断依赖于CT扫描中识别肺部病变.
- 这些病变的准确细分对于患者的监测和治疗至关重要.
- 现有的细分方法可能缺乏效率或精度.
研究的目的:
- 开发一种新的深度学习网络,用于CT图像中精确细分COVID-19肺部病变.
- 为了提高COVID-19诊断和监测的病变细分的准确性和效率.
主要方法:
- 提出了一种渐进型密度剩余聚变网络 (PDRF-Net),包括密度跳过连接和高效的聚合剩余模块.
- 集成了一个视觉变压器和残余块,用于增强特征提取.
- 引入了双边通道像素加权模块,用于逐步融合多分支特征地图.
主要成果:
- 在两个COVID-19数据集上,PDRF-Net实现了卓越的细分性能.
- 与基线方法 (11.6%和11.1%) 和其他主流方法相比,已经显示出显著的改进.
- 该模型在细分COVID-19肺部CT图像方面证明有效.
结论:
- PDRF-Net是一种高性能,易于训练的深度学习模型,用于COVID-19肺部CT细分.
- 拟议的网络为COVID-19诊断和管理中的临床应用提供了一个有希望的工具.

Radiological Investigation III: Pulmonary Angiogram and PET Scan
Radiological investigations are paramount in the diagnosis and management of various pulmonary diseases. Two essential investigations are the Pulmonary Angiogram and the Positron Emission Tomography (PET) Scan.

Imaging Studies for Cardiovascular System V: CT
Cardiac computed tomography (CT) scanning is an advanced cardiac imaging technique that utilizes CT technology, with or without intravenous (IV) contrast, to produce accurate cross-sectional virtual slices of specific areas of the heart, coronary circulation, and major blood vessels such as the aorta, pulmonary veins, and arteries.
